Example product loading & making your first booking using TourCMS
This screencast takes you through:
- Creating a tour (a scuba diving weekend)
- Creating an option (for example "mask hire")
- Making an online booking
- Finding the booking within the main booking administration section

The following steps describe exactly the steps followed in the screencast above:
Step 1: Add a tour A tour is a basic product type
- Go to TOURS
- Create a new tour - for example "Scuba diving weekend"
- You can now see the tour on the tour list page. The row is in yellow because new tours are initially highlighted.
- Go into SETUP (for the scuba diving weekend tour)
- On the first tab - tick "Book by web & staff". This makes the tour bookable online
- Go back to the tours list
- Click on DATES & PRICES. Then click on "View and edit departures" (a departure is a kind of tour with a fixed start and end date.... the most basic form of a travel event)
- Add a couple of dates. You need to add a start date and an end date
- On the dates you have added, untick the "CLOSE" column tick.... this will make that date bookable
Step 2: Add an option An option is a travel product that is added to a tour - optional
- From the homepage, go to OPTIONS
- Create a new option - for example "Mask hire"
- You can now see the option on the option list page. The row is in yellow because new options are initially highlighted.
- Go into SETUP (for the mask hire option)
- Tick "Book by web & staff". This makes the option bookable online (if you just wanted this option to be bookable by staff, you would leave this unticked)
- Go back to the options list
- Click on DATES & PRICES
- Add an option season and an associated price. A season is normally a long period of time.... so ensure you add a date that is several months long... and overlaps with the dates you added for the tour earlier
Step 3: Add the option to the tour An option must be explicitly added to a tour so that they are associated
- From the homepage, go to TOURS
- Select OPTIONS on the "scuba diving weekend" tour
- Add the "mask hire" option to the tour
Step 4: Find the online booking URL If you want to get going quickly, add this URL to your existing website
- From the homepage, go to TOURS
- Select SETUP on the "scuba diving weekend" tour
- On the first tab, you can see the online booking URL (If you can't see it, ensure that you have ticked the "Book by Web & Staff" tickbox, save changes, and then go back into the SETUP page)
Step 5: Make an online booking You can change text, colours and add images to the booking engine - to make it look much like your own website
- Select the month that you entered dates in previously
- Make a booking and remember the reference number!
Step 6: Find your booking in TourCMS This is the simple search.... there are many more complex booking search types and reports!
- From the TourCMS homepage type in your booking reference in the booking search box
- As you are typing, details about the booking will show in the box (to help you ensure you are going to the right booking)
- Hit ENTER (return) on your keyboard twice.... and you will go to the booking (no need to pickup the mouse)
- Voila! You have made your first booking
